Summary: Cilla, you're the only woman for me!
Comment: This is the film based on the book Elvis & Me which is Priscilla's official version of events on life with the King. It sticks pretty closely to the events in the book but how true they are, only she knows.

The actress playing Priscilla looks quite like her but Dale Midkiff, who plays Elvis is nothing like him although having said that, is a good looking guy in his own right. It shows Priscilla as the loving girlfriend and wife who is driven to leaving her man by his abuse of drugs and women, which is probably true. Large chunks are missed completely, the famous comeback, Elvis's disillusionment with his career and the fact they had no marriage after the birth of Lisa Marie, his obsession with religion and hardly any mention of the Colonel.

However, I think Priscilla put up with a lot and has, when all is said and done, given Elvis the career, in death, that he should have had in life.

However, some of the scenes are hilarious, the honeymoon scene is moronic, Elvis running out of the bedroom with his police torch and throwning it at the wall, Elvis turning up in 1976 to Priscilla "modest" home with his jump suit on (give me a break!). Did he want her back, who knows?

If you want a good laugh and have 3 hours to spare buy this and be glad you ain't famous! I gave it 4 stars cos it gave me such a laugh.
